Artists like to use the moon as a theme, but the "moon shadow under the sun" on Qiaozui Island is not just poetry, but is actually related to the landform: Liandao sandbar is submerged every time the water rises, and the road at the other end of the island is submerged. It doesn't work, but it will show up when the water recedes. The artist just wants to show this feature with twelve vine-woven moons (different shapes).
"The twelve large and small spheres surrounding the moon are like ancient timekeeping instruments—the sundial"

- One of the limited works of the "Sai Kung Maritime Art Festival", the artwork in the painting is set on the Liandao sandbar on Kiu Tsui Island. The designer then creates with electronic hand-painted drawings and prints the finished product on a white cotton Tote Bag. The size is 38cm X 35cm.
